Chuck Norris Dies At Age 86

Actor and martial artist died after medical emergency in Hawaii.

The death of actor and martial artist Chuck Norris, at age 86, was confirmed by his family following a medical emergency on the island of Kauai, Hawaii. The circumstances of his death were not detailed, at the request of his family to preserve their privacy during this time of mourning.

Norris was taken to a hospital after a sudden health problem developed over the course of the week. Until then, there had been no public indication of his condition worsening, as the actor remained active and had even trained normally in the days prior.

Sudden emergency surprised family and friends

According to reports, the situation occurred unexpectedly. On the Wednesday before his hospitalization, Chuck Norris was still maintaining his training routine and even spoke on the phone with a friend, demonstrating good humor and energy.

The family has not confirmed the cause of death and reiterated that they prefer to keep the details confidential. In an official statement, relatives highlighted the actor’s personal and public impact:

To the world, he was a martial artist, actor, and a symbol of strength. To us, he was a devoted husband, a loving father and grandfather, an incredible brother, and the heart of our family.”

A career marked by film, television, and martial arts

Born in 1940 in the state of Oklahoma, in the United States, Chuck Norris began his military career, serving in the Air Force between 1958 and 1962. After that period, he built a solid career in martial arts and film.

He became one of the leading names in action films of the 1980s and 1990s, particularly in productions that showcased his technical prowess in fighting. One of his best-known roles was that of Texas Ranger Cordell Walker, the protagonist of the CBS series “Walker, Texas Ranger”.

Throughout his life, Norris received important accolades, including a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ame in 1989 and the honorary title of Texas Ranger, awarded in 2010.

Personal life and later years

Chuck Norris was married twice and had five children, including actor Mike Norris and NASCAR driver Eric Norris. In recent years, he faced significant family losses, such as the death of his mother in 2024 and his first wife, Dianne Holechek, in December 2025.

Even with less screen time in recent decades, he still participated in occasional productions, such as the film “The Expendables 2,” released in 2012. Recently, he celebrated his birthday with a video posted on social media, in which he appeared training.

Family highlights legacy and asks for privacy

In the statement released after his death, his family emphasized the magnitude of the legacy left by the actor:

“He lived his life with faith, purpose, and an unwavering commitment to the people he loved. Through his work, discipline, and kindness, he inspired millions around the world and left a lasting impact on so many lives.” The family also expressed gratitude for the support received from fans:

“For him, you weren’t just fans — you were his friends.”

The statement concludes with a request for respect during this time of mourning, as relatives and friends cope with the loss of one of the most iconic figures in pop culture and martial arts.
